Enum juniper::Type

source ·
pub enum Type<'a> {
    Named(Cow<'a, str>),
    List(Box<Type<'a>>),
    NonNullNamed(Cow<'a, str>),
    NonNullList(Box<Type<'a>>),
}
Expand description

A type literal in the syntax tree

This enum carries no semantic information and might refer to types that do not exist.

Variants§

§

Named(Cow<'a, str>)

A nullable named type, e.g. String

§

List(Box<Type<'a>>)

A nullable list type, e.g. [String]

The list itself is what’s nullable, the containing type might be non-null.

§

NonNullNamed(Cow<'a, str>)

A non-null named type, e.g. String!

§

NonNullList(Box<Type<'a>>)

A non-null list type, e.g. [String]!.

The list itself is what’s non-null, the containing type might be null.

Implementations§

source§

impl<'a> Type<'a>

source

pub fn name(&self) -> Option<&str>

Get the name of a named type.

Only applies to named types; lists will return None.

source

pub fn innermost_name(&self) -> &str

Get the innermost name by unpacking lists

All type literals contain exactly one named type.

source

pub fn is_non_null(&self) -> bool

Determines if a type only can represent non-null values.
